The Role
Working closely with teaching staff and senior leaders, you’ll support learners both inside and outside the classroom, helping them develop academically, emotionally, and socially.
You’ll play a key role in:
Supporting learners on a 1:1 basis and in small groups Promoting engagement, attendance, and positive behaviour Supporting emotional regulation and pastoral wellbeing Assisting with classroom delivery and learning activities Helping create a calm, inclusive, and structured environment Supporting educational visits and enrichment activities Maintaining safeguarding and learner welfare standards Building positive, consistent relationships with young people
What We’re Looking For Essential: Teaching Assistant qualification Experience working within schools or educational settings Experience supporting young people with behavioural, emotional, SEND, or additional learning needs A strong ability to break down barriers
Desirable: HLTA qualification Experience within Alternative Provision or specialist education settings Experience delivering interventions or structured activities Additional training in SEND, behaviour, or emotional regulation support
